Unraveling the Deep Ocean's Mysteries: Scientific Exploration and Challenges
The deep ocean, a vast and largely unexplored realm, holds the key to understanding our planet's history, biodiversity, and future. Covering over 70% of the Earth's surface, this mysterious environment remains one of the last great frontiers of scientific exploration. But venturing into these inky depths presents significant challenges, demanding innovative technologies and collaborative efforts. This article delves into the ongoing scientific exploration of the deep ocean, highlighting both the remarkable discoveries and the formidable obstacles researchers face.
The Allure of the Abyss: What Drives Deep Ocean Exploration?
The motivations behind deep ocean exploration are multifaceted. From understanding the impact of climate change on marine ecosystems to discovering new life forms and resources, the potential benefits are immense. Scientists are particularly interested in:
- Biodiversity: The deep ocean harbors a surprising diversity of life, adapted to extreme pressure, darkness, and cold. Discovering and studying these organisms can unlock secrets to evolution, biomedicine, and even inspire new technologies. [Link to a reputable source on deep-sea biodiversity]
- Climate Change: The deep ocean plays a crucial role in regulating the Earth's climate by absorbing vast amounts of carbon dioxide. Research in this area is critical for understanding and predicting the effects of climate change. [Link to a reputable source on climate change and the deep ocean]
- Geological Processes: Studying the deep ocean floor provides insights into plate tectonics, seafloor spreading, and the formation of hydrothermal vents – unique ecosystems teeming with life fueled by chemosynthesis, not photosynthesis. [Link to a reputable source on deep-sea geology]
- Resource Discovery: The deep ocean contains valuable resources, including minerals and potentially new sources of energy. However, responsible exploration and extraction are crucial to minimize environmental impact. [Link to a reputable source on deep-sea mining]
Conquering the Depths: Technological Advancements and Exploration Methods
Exploring the deep ocean requires specialized technology capable of withstanding the extreme pressure and challenging conditions. Key advancements include:
- Remotely Operated Vehicles (ROVs): These unmanned underwater robots are equipped with cameras, manipulators, and sensors, allowing scientists to explore the ocean floor remotely and collect samples.
- Autonomous Underwater Vehicles (AUVs): AUVs operate independently, covering vast areas and collecting data over extended periods. They are particularly useful for mapping the seafloor and monitoring environmental changes.
- Human-Occupied Vehicles (HOVs): While costly and complex, HOVs allow scientists to directly observe and interact with the deep ocean environment, providing unparalleled opportunities for research. The famous Alvin submersible is a prime example.
The Challenges of Deep Ocean Exploration
Despite technological advancements, exploring the deep ocean presents numerous challenges:
- Extreme Pressure: The immense pressure at depth requires robust and specialized equipment.
- Darkness: The absence of sunlight necessitates the use of artificial lighting and specialized imaging techniques.
- Cold Temperatures: The frigid temperatures can affect equipment performance and require specialized materials.
- Cost and Logistics: Deep ocean exploration is expensive, requiring substantial funding and logistical support.
- Environmental Protection: Minimizing the environmental impact of exploration is paramount, demanding careful planning and responsible practices.
